The LT1118CS8-5#TRPBF belongs to the category of voltage regulators.
This product is commonly used in electronic circuits to regulate and stabilize voltage levels.
The LT1118CS8-5#TRPBF comes in an 8-pin surface mount package (SMD).
The essence of the LT1118CS8-5#TRPBF is to provide reliable and stable voltage regulation for electronic devices.
This product is typically packaged in reels or tubes, containing a specific quantity of units per package.
The LT1118CS8-5#TRPBF is a linear voltage regulator that uses a feedback mechanism to maintain a constant output voltage. It compares the output voltage with a reference voltage and adjusts the internal circuitry to compensate for any variations. By controlling the pass transistor, it regulates the output voltage within the specified range.
The LT1118CS8-5#TRPBF finds applications in various electronic devices and systems, including: 1. Battery-powered devices 2. Portable audio players 3. Mobile phones 4. Embedded systems 5. Automotive electronics

Sure! Here are 10 common questions and answers related to the application of LT1118CS8-5#TRPBF in technical solutions:
Q: What is the LT1118CS8-5#TRPBF? A: The LT1118CS8-5#TRPBF is a low dropout (LDO) linear regulator IC that provides a fixed output voltage of 5V.
Q: What is the input voltage range for the LT1118CS8-5#TRPBF? A: The input voltage range for the LT1118CS8-5#TRPBF is typically between 2.7V and 20V.
Q: What is the maximum output current of the LT1118CS8-5#TRPBF? A: The LT1118CS8-5#TRPBF can provide a maximum output current of 800mA.
Q: Can the LT1118CS8-5#TRPBF be used in battery-powered applications? A: Yes, the LT1118CS8-5#TRPBF is suitable for battery-powered applications due to its low dropout voltage and low quiescent current.
Q: Does the LT1118CS8-5#TRPBF require any external components for operation? A: Yes, the LT1118CS8-5#TRPBF requires an input capacitor and an output capacitor for stability and proper operation.
Q: What is the dropout voltage of the LT1118CS8-5#TRPBF? A: The dropout voltage of the LT1118CS8-5#TRPBF is typically around 300mV at full load.
Q: Can the LT1118CS8-5#TRPBF handle input voltage fluctuations? A: Yes, the LT1118CS8-5#TRPBF has built-in protection features to handle input voltage fluctuations and provide a stable output voltage.
Q: Is the LT1118CS8-5#TRPBF suitable for noise-sensitive applications? A: Yes, the LT1118CS8-5#TRPBF has excellent line and load regulation characteristics, making it suitable for noise-sensitive applications.
Q: Can the LT1118CS8-5#TRPBF be used in automotive applications? A: Yes, the LT1118CS8-5#TRPBF is designed to meet automotive specifications and can be used in automotive applications.
Q: What is the package type of the LT1118CS8-5#TRPBF? A: The LT1118CS8-5#TRPBF is available in an 8-pin SOIC (Small Outline Integrated Circuit) package.
